Description

Recently refurbished to include a modern cream style dining kitchen and decorated throughout, and conveniently situated to take advantage of the local amenities, this traditional 3 bedroom semi detached home is offered with the benefit of NO ONWARD CHAIN. Considered to be an excellent first family home or investor opportunity the home includes a generous forward facing lounge, 16’5 dining kitchen and a first floor bathroom. In addition to the 2 car reception parking there is a long, enclosed rear garden ideal for both children and pets. Naturally it benefits from both double glazing and gas fired heating to ensure efficient comfort.


EPC Rating: D

Entrance

A upvc door opens to the reception lobby with stair to the first floor and radiator.

Lounge

4.32m x 4.04m

A bright forward facing room with radiator, wall mounted modern electric fire and deep cupboard.

Dining Kitchen

5m x 2.43m

An excellent informal entertaining space linking to the rear garden and recently refurbished with a good range of high and low cream fronted units with light granite style tops with free standing gas cooker, space for an under the counter refrigerator, plumbing for a washing machine and wall mounted gas fired boiler.

Landing

Centrally placed with window, radiator and access to the roof space.

Bedroom 1

3.31m x 3.04m

A forward facing double room with radiator.

Bedroom 2

2.51m x 3.52m

A further, rear facing double room with radiator.

Bedroom 3

2.5m x 2.44m

The final, rear facing room with vertical radiator.

Bathroom

Appointed with a suite in white to include a wash hand basin with cupboard under, bath with mixer shower over, close coupled wc, extractor fan, electric heater and part panelled walls.

Front Garden

A low block wall opens to a 2 car block paved reception area with side shrub border. A narrow, shared drive extends to the rear.

Rear Garden

high timber gates open to the rear of the home where there is a large concrete hardstanding area together with a block paved patio which overlooks a long lawn with central path and raised garden area. A timber shed and garden toilet completes the home.
